Bunny’s Main Ability

Bunny focuses entirely on movement. At its basic level, the pet gives the player +5 walking speed when equipped. While this is not a huge bonus, it can be surprisingly useful during normal farming sessions.

Players frequently move between their garden, the central market area, and different activity locations. Faster movement means less time spent walking and more time available for planting, collecting, trading, and managing resources. Because the ability works passively, there is no need to activate a skill at the right moment.

How Bunny Gets Stronger

Bunny can become more useful as it gains levels. Its movement bonus may increase from the basic +5 to +10 and eventually +15 at higher stages. These improvements make continued use more worthwhile, especially for players who prefer a mobility-focused setup.

The exact statistics and appearance rates may change over time as the game receives updates. Players should therefore treat older numbers as general guidance rather than permanent rules.

For collectors, there is also the Sugar Bunny variant. It shares the movement theme of the regular Bunny but can provide additional jump height alongside its walking speed bonus.

Finding Bunny Quickly

Bunny can appear in the central area between the market stalls and players’ gardens. This area is worth checking regularly because pets may only remain available for a short period.

When Bunny appears, approach it and interact with it to see its price. The cost is displayed in Shekels, so having enough currency ready before searching is important. Players who arrive without enough money may have to wait for another opportunity.

The central area can also become crowded when a desirable pet appears. Moving quickly can therefore be just as important as having enough currency.

Protecting Your Purchase

The acquisition process does not end the moment you pay for Bunny. After purchase, the pet must travel back toward your garden. During this time, another player may be able to take it by paying double the original price.

Because of this mechanic, players should avoid leaving the area immediately after buying Bunny. Stay close and make sure the pet reaches the garden safely.

Once Bunny has successfully returned and entered your Backpack, it is secure. You can then equip it whenever you want to benefit from its movement bonus.

Equipping Bunny From Your Backpack

Equipping the pet is straightforward. Open your Backpack, locate Bunny in your pet collection, and select the equip option. Once active, the movement bonus will be applied automatically.

This simplicity makes Bunny particularly suitable for beginners. New players do not need to understand complicated combat rotations or special activation requirements. They can simply equip Bunny and continue farming.
